The Immigrant Council for Arts Innovation (ICAI) is an arts council based in Calgary. The council was founded in January 2019 with the expressed purpose of connecting newcomer and immigrant artists, arts administrators and culture workers to the existing arts community in Calgary.

ICAI actively encourages diversity of expression and culture through the creation of a safe and welcoming community where newcomer and immigrant art workers feel confident to share their work and distinct cultural identities.
